Transaction 5157819ff8a92a611ab945fec100fc51bbad1c5026900674fce33e4c9469da5a
1 Input
1 Output
-
5157819ff8a92a611ab945fec100fc51bbad1c5026900674fce33e4c9469da5a:0
- value
- 12123912
- script pubkey
- OP_0 OP_PUSHBYTES_20 58abeadd15e4fceca5bed5cdfc299aa0970872c2
- address
- bc1qtz474hg4un7wefd76hxlc2v65ztssukzqdleny